#ifndef _NFT_H_
#define _NFT_H_
#include "xshared.h"
#include "nft-shared.h"
struct nft_handle {
int family;
struct mnl_socket *nl;
uint32_t portid;
uint32_t seq;
bool commit;
struct nft_family_ops *ops;
};
int nft_init(struct nft_handle *h);
void nft_fini(struct nft_handle *h);
/*
* Operations with tables.
*/
struct nft_table;
struct nft_chain_list;
int nft_table_add(struct nft_handle *h, const struct nft_table *t);
int nft_for_each_table(struct nft_handle *h, int (*func)(struct nft_handle *h, const char *tablename, bool counters), bool counters);
bool nft_table_find(struct nft_handle *h, const char *tablename);
int nft_table_set_dormant(struct nft_handle *h, const char *table);
int nft_table_wake_dormant(struct nft_handle *h, const char *table);
int nft_table_purge_chains(struct nft_handle *h, const char *table, struct nft_chain_list *list);
/*
* Operations with chains.
*/
struct nft_chain;
int nft_chain_add(struct nft_handle *h, const struct nft_chain *c);
int nft_chain_set(struct nft_handle *h, const char *table, const char *chain, const char *policy, const struct xt_counters *counters);
struct nft_chain_list *nft_chain_dump(struct nft_handle *h);
struct nft_chain *nft_chain_list_find(struct nft_chain_list *list, const char *table, const char *chain);
int nft_chain_save(struct nft_handle *h, struct nft_chain_list *list, const char *table);
int nft_chain_user_add(struct nft_handle *h, const char *chain, const char *table);
int nft_chain_user_del(struct nft_handle *h, const char *chain, const char *table);
int nft_chain_user_rename(struct nft_handle *h, const char *chain, const char *table, const char *newname);
int nft_chain_zero_counters(struct nft_handle *h, const char *chain, const char *table);
/*
* Operations with rule-set.
*/
struct nft_rule;
int nft_rule_append(struct nft_handle *h, const char *chain, const char *table, struct iptables_command_state *cmd, uint64_t handle, bool verbose);
int nft_rule_insert(struct nft_handle *h, const char *chain, const char *table, struct iptables_command_state *cmd, int rulenum, bool verbose);
int nft_rule_check(struct nft_handle *h, const char *chain, const char *table, struct iptables_command_state *cmd, bool verbose);
int nft_rule_delete(struct nft_handle *h, const char *chain, const char *table, struct iptables_command_state *cmd, bool verbose);
int nft_rule_delete_num(struct nft_handle *h, const char *chain, const char *table, int rulenum, bool verbose);
int nft_rule_replace(struct nft_handle *h, const char *chain, const char *table, struct iptables_command_state *cmd, int rulenum, bool verbose);
int nft_rule_list(struct nft_handle *h, const char *chain, const char *table, int rulenum, unsigned int format);
int nft_rule_list_save(struct nft_handle *h, const char *chain, const char *table, int rulenum, int counters);
int nft_rule_save(struct nft_handle *h, const char *table, bool counters);
int nft_rule_flush(struct nft_handle *h, const char *chain, const char *table);
enum nft_rule_print {
NFT_RULE_APPEND,
NFT_RULE_DEL,
};
void nft_rule_print_save(struct nft_rule *r, enum nft_rule_print type, bool counters);
/*
* global commit and abort
*/
int nft_commit(struct nft_handle *h);
int nft_abort(struct nft_handle *h);
/*
* revision compatibility.
*/
int nft_compatible_revision(const char *name, uint8_t rev, int opt);
/*
* Error reporting.
*/
const char *nft_strerror(int err);
/* For xtables.c */
int do_commandx(struct nft_handle *h, int argc, char *argv[], char **table);
/*
* Parse config for tables and chain helper functions
*/
#define XTABLES_CONFIG_DEFAULT "/etc/xtables.conf"
struct nft_table_list;
struct nft_chain_list;
extern int xtables_config_parse(const char *filename, struct nft_table_list *table_list, struct nft_chain_list *chain_list);
enum {
NFT_LOAD_VERBOSE = (1 << 0),
};
int nft_xtables_config_load(struct nft_handle *h, const char *filename, uint32_t flags);
#endif
